<p>The Motor Operated Air Circuit Breaker (ACB) is a robust solution designed for industrial and commercial applications, offering reliable protection and control over electrical circuits. With its versatile rated current range of 2000-5000 A, this ACB is well-suited for large-scale operations requiring substantial power management.</p><p>Engineered to withstand demanding conditions, the device boasts a rated impulse withstand voltage of 12 kV and a rated insulation voltage of 1000 VAC. These features ensure that the circuit breaker can handle high-voltage surges while maintaining electrical integrity across its lifespan.</p><p>A standout feature of this ACB is its impressive breaking capacity of 100 kA, paired with a rated short time withstand current also at 100 kA. This makes it highly effective in managing fault currents without compromising safety or performance. The breaker operates efficiently within systems up to 690 VAC, making it adaptable to various power distribution networks.</p><p>Incorporating the Ekip Touch LSIG trip unit, this ACB offers advanced protection functions such as long-time (L), short-time (S), instantaneous (I), and ground fault (G) protections. This ensures precise fault detection and interruption capabilities tailored to specific operational needs.</p><p>Designed with practicality in mind, the product features a horizontal rear spread terminal type which simplifies installation and integration into existing setups. Its frame size E6.2 further enhances compatibility with industry-standard enclosures.</p><p>Despite its powerful performance attributes, the motor-operated mechanism maintains an efficient power loss rating at just 850 W, contributing to overall energy savings in extensive installations.</p><p>Complying with IEC 309 standards and approvals guarantees that this circuit breaker meets international quality benchmarks for safety and reliability—a crucial consideration for engineers seeking dependable solutions in complex environments.</p><p>This Motor Operated ACB combines durability with cutting-edge technology to deliver optimal performance where it counts most—ensuring your operations are protected against unforeseen electrical events while maximizing uptime efficiency.</p>
